The problems below are a review of some of the concepts we covered previously. Find the following products. (Multiply.) $$3.18 \times 1.2$$
Step-by-Step Solution
Verified Answer
The product of 3.18 and 1.2 is 3.816.
1Step 1: Set Up the Problem
Identify the numbers to be multiplied, which are 3.18 and 1.2, and write them in a vertical multiplication format.
2Step 2: Multiply Without Decimals
Ignore the decimals initially and multiply 318 by 12. Calculate the product:\[318 \times 12 = 3816\]
3Step 3: Account for Decimals
Count the total number of decimal places in the original numbers. There are two decimal places in 3.18 and one decimal place in 1.2. Therefore, the total number of decimal places is three.
4Step 4: Place the Decimal in the Product
Starting from the right, move the decimal point in the product 3816 three places to the left to adjust for the total decimal places from the original numbers. This gives us 3.816 as the final product.

Understanding Place Value in Decimal Multiplication
Place value is a fundamental concept that helps us understand how to work with numbers, especially decimals. Each digit in a number has a place value, which determines its value based on its position. For example, in the number 3.18:
- The digit '3' is in the units place, representing 3 whole units.
- The digit '1' is in the tenths place, representing one-tenth or 0.1.
- The digit '8' is in the hundredths place, representing eight hundredths or 0.08.
The Steps of Vertical Multiplication
Vertical multiplication is a method where we align numbers vertically and multiply large numbers systematically. It is particularly useful for multiplying numbers with more than one digit. Here's a quick guide:
- Align the numbers by the right and write them on top of each other, just like you would for simple arithmetic.
- Multiply each digit in the bottom number by each digit in the top number, starting from the rightmost digit.
- Move one place to the left for each new digit and add the results accordingly.
The Importance of Rounding Decimals
Rounding decimals makes numbers easier to work with, especially when dealing with lengthy calculations or approximating results. It involves adjusting a decimal to a nearby convenient number. Here’s how it works:
- Look at the digit in place value immediately to the right of the place to which you want to round.
- If this digit is 5 or more, round up. If it's less than 5, keep the digit the same.
